One PlayStation user has reported on Reddit a very cheap payment for a PlayStation Plus subscription and it has left other players confused and surprised.

The Redditor ‘nothing533439878’ came to the PlayStation Plus subreddit and declared, “Just got PS plus premium for 0.06 dollars (for 1 day) AMA”

The thread caused instant confusion mostly because it’s hard to fathom why somebody would only pay $0.06 for one day of the PlayStation service.

Further down the thread, the original user did break down what they did with those simple 24 hours.

“I wanted to see Sony pictures core (when I open it it shows a white screen and doesn’t work) and I wanted to try premium games and I also wanted to try streaming games and it was all a lot of fun best 0.06$ I’ve ever spent, probably.”

Of course, Reddit had some humour for the thread, though most people jumped in to say something along the lines of “Don’t forget to turn off auto-renew.”

Because a one-day experiment can soon get pricey if this is forgotten.

I didn’t even know you could pay for just one day of PlayStation Plus and it seems like a decent way to give certain services a try.

This is particularly handy if you want to test out cloud streaming and are unsure whether your network speeds will support decent play.

It sounds like that’s what this user was doing.

There was a little confusion, however, as the post shows a 12-month subscription as the main image at checkout.

One reply said, “Does your credit card get charged more than 6 pennies for 1 purchase?”

Another user also had a question, saying, “How? I'm kinda confused, and it shows 12 months.”

Confusion aside, it would be interesting to see Sony implement one-day passes across the world.
